Lobuche East Peak Climbing has two distinct highest points Lobuche East Peak Climbing (6119 m) and Lobuche West Peak (6145 m) associated by means of a blade edge. Base Camp Trek is situated not a long way from the Lobuche town toward the south. It gives simple access toward the south edge. Lobuche East Peak has an exceptionally sensational edge toward the east, framing a three-furrowed pyramid. The south and Southeast Edges structure a run-of-the-mill rock triangle reaching out to the Khumbu icy mass moraine. The Peak drastically towers over the town and is effectively recognizable from the Everest trail.

We approach Lobuche East Peak Climbing by means of the Everest trail from Lukla, following a short 35-minute departure from Kathmandu and a little ways from Manthali, Ramechhap. We clear our path through different Sherpa towns towards Namche Bazaar – the key-exchanging town of the area, giving access to the higher valleys. Not only that, but we proceed to the popular cloister Tengboche while in transit, to which we ought to get our first perspective on Everest and Lhotse. Furthermore, we proceed with the right to Gorak Shep (5170 m) as a feature of the acclimatization stage. We at that point take on Kalapatthar (5545 m), a satellite pinnacle of Pumori, for a great perspective on Mt. Everest and the Khumbu Icefall. We can visit the Everest Base Camp Trek in Nepal, which is just a short climb away. Likewise, we at that point come back to Lobuche where we get supplies and trek to High camp (5600 m). Taking into account a further 1 day of acclimatization whenever required, we at that point start the move along the South Edge to the culmination (6119 m).

The perspectives from the base camp, the climbing course, and at last the culmination are wonderful. The highest point edge offers a panoramic scene of the area, including Ama Dablam, Pumori, and Everest. Unquestionably an exceptional encounter!
